Ensure the wheel is powered on and fully calibrated before launching the game. If you launch the game while the wheel is unplugged, Bus Simulator 21 defaults back to keyboard controls.

The combination of a belt and gear mechanism provides smooth, predictable force feedback without the notchiness of pure gear wheels. This makes long, sweeping turns through Angel Shores or Seaside Valley feel highly realistic.

The T3PM pedals shine when managing passenger comfort. Bus Simulator 21 penalizes your income if you brake too hard, causing passengers to stumble. Use the stiffest black spring included with your T248 pedals, but configure the in-game deadzones so that the first 20% of pedal travel engages the retarder/slow braking. Only compress the pedal fully when coming to a complete stop at a designated bay. Utilizing the Dashboard Display
The genre of vehicle simulation has evolved significantly from a niche hobby into a complex, technical pastime. At the forefront of this evolution is Bus Simulator 21 , a game that demands precision, patience, and a deep understanding of traffic mechanics. While it is possible to navigate the streets of Angel Shores with a standard gamepad, the experience is fundamentally transformed by the introduction of a dedicated racing wheel. Among the myriad of options on the market, the Thrustmaster T248 has emerged as a compelling choice for sim enthusiasts. By blending multi-platform versatility with force feedback technology designed for varied driving disciplines, the T248 offers a robust, immersive experience that elevates Bus Simulator 21 from a casual driving game to a convincing simulation of public transit management.
